    Mith,

    With regards to the Non Aggression Pact (NAP). Team RB would like to extended this as follows:

    Terms:
    1) Imperio and Team RB enter a NAP until Turn 150.
    2) The NAP can be canceled by either team at any time.
    3) War between Imperio and Team RB cannot be declared until 10 turns after cancellation (or Turn 160 if NAP expires with no cancellation)

    Also - we would like to execute a tech trade ... do any of the following options interest you?

    'Aesthetics' for 'Mathematics'
    'Aesthetics' for 'Monarchy'

    We also have Monotheism that we might include to sweeten the deal.
